Overview

Massena, NY has 11 registered structures, the tallest standing 115 m (377 ft) above ground.

Counted against 9,898 residents, that is 111.1 per 100,000 — worth reading alongside area density, since structures cluster along roads and ridgelines rather than where people sleep.

The median registered structure here stands 61 m (199 ft); the tallest reaches 115 m (377 ft).

Lattice towers (3) and guyed masts (1) between them make up much of the register here — both are older, taller designs than the monopoles that dominate newer urban sites.

Registrations here span 1959 to 2025.

About this data

These counts come from the FCC Antenna Structure Registration database, weekly file dated 2026-08-23. Registration is generally required above 200 feet or near an airport, so small cells, rooftop antennas and short masts do not appear.

"Owner" is the entity that registered the structure, usually a tower company such as American Tower or Crown Castle. It does not indicate which carriers operate equipment on the structure.
